mysql添加字段且第一如何优化MySQL数据库表结构,让你的网站更高效

更新时间:02-11 教程 由 妄臣 分享

MySQL添加字段且第一:如何优化MySQL数据库表结构,让你的网站更高效?

MySQL是目前使用最广泛的关系型数据库管理系统之一,是Web应用程序的重要组成部分。在开发Web应用程序时,优化MySQL数据库表结构是非常重要的,因为它可以使你的网站更加高效。在本文中,我们将探讨如何在MySQL中添加字段并优化数据库表结构。

一、理解数据库表结构

在MySQL中,每个表都由行和列组成,行表示表中的每个记录,而列表示每个记录中的数据类型。优化MySQL数据库表结构是指通过修改表的列、索引和数据类型等来提高查询性能和数据访问速度。

二、添加字段

在MySQL中添加字段是一项非常容易的任务。只需使用ALTER TABLE语句即可。

amename data_type;

ail”的字段,可以使用以下语句:

ail VARCHAR(255);

ail”的VARCHAR类型的字段,其长度为255个字符。

三、优化数据库表结构

优化MySQL数据库表结构可以通过以下几种方式来实现:

1. 确保每个表都有一个主键

主键是用来唯一标识每个记录的字段。如果表没有主键,MySQL将不得不进行全表扫描来查找记录,这将使查询变得非常缓慢。因此,为每个表添加一个主键是非常重要的。

2. 使用正确的数据类型

使用正确的数据类型可以提高查询性能和减少存储空间。例如,如果你知道一个字段只会包含整数,那么最好使用INT数据类型而不是VARCHAR。

3. 索引

索引是用来加速查询的。它们可以减少MySQL扫描整个表的时间。在添加索引时,应该考虑使用复合索引,这样可以同时索引多个列。然而,过多的索引可能会导致性能下降。

4. 规范化数据

规范化数据是指将数据分解为多个表,以便更好地管理和查询数据。这将使查询更快,并减少数据冗余。

5. 分区

如果表中的数据量非常大,可以考虑使用分区。分区是将表分成多个部分,使查询更快,并减少锁定时间。

MySQL是一个强大的数据库管理系统,但只有在正确地优化数据库表结构时,才能发挥其最大的优势。通过添加字段、使用正确的数据类型、索引、规范化数据和分区,可以使你的网站更加高效。

声明:关于《mysql添加字段且第一如何优化MySQL数据库表结构,让你的网站更高效》以上内容仅供参考,若您的权利被侵害,请联系13825271@qq.com
本文网址:http://www.25820.com/tutorial/14_2138990.html